Some homes just settle you as soon as you walk in. That is what happened when I visited this four bedroom apartment in Bluewaters Residences. You step through the door and it stays quiet except for the soft sound of the AC. I remember taking a few steps and just glancing out the huge windows. You get these wide views over the Arabian Gulf that really do make you pause for a second or two. The water almost looks like it is moving a bit slower from this high up. Sometimes you just find yourself standing there without really thinking about your phone or anything else.
Thing is, Bluewaters is set just off Jumeirah Beach Residences but you feel tucked away from the energy and the rush of it all. The little island is very walkable and kind of peaceful most of the time, except when families are heading out for breakfast or maybe people cycling in the morning. The building itself is modern but it is definitely not cold, and the atmosphere just feels right for families who want space close to the city without needing to be in the middle of everything. You get a sense of being in Dubai but also a world apart which is not something you find too often.
Now, about the apartment itself. The space is generous with a built up area around two thousand four hundred fifty nine square feet which means no one feels crowded. Open plan in the main area so you have that living, dining, and kitchen space that all just flows. Honestly, it is the kind of layout where nobody gets boxed in. You could be cooking and still chat with everyone sitting at the table or hanging out on the sofa. The kitchen has proper Italian appliances and it actually feels like somewhere you would cook for real not just heat something up. When I saw the counters I thought these are not just for show. You could cook for a big group or even just sit with a coffee and a quiet moment by yourself on an early weekend morning with the sunlight coming through.
The floors are that warm wood that makes everything feel softer under your feet. Plenty of natural light seeps in here even late in the day so you never really need to worry about turning the lights on. The bedrooms are all big and tucked away a bit so you have privacy when you want it. Each one has its own en suite bath which means nobody is fighting over the shower before school or work. I liked how each bedroom leads out to a balcony and there is enough space out there for a couple of chairs and maybe a small table. You can stand outside catch a breeze and just watch the city in the distance or read a book on a slow evening. The views are pretty lovely stretching over Ain Dubai and JBR along with the landscaped gardens below. Sometimes you spot boats making their way along the Gulf and for a moment it almost feels like being on holiday.
The style inside is mostly neutral with little touches of gold or brass here and there. It is not flashy just modern and calm. To me the Scandinavian feel works so well especially when you want a place to really live in not treat like a showroom. You will also notice the closets and storage spaces because honestly who doesn't need a bit more of those. If your family has sneakers or jackets or just random toys you will appreciate the storage.
Parking here is actually easy and convenient which is a big deal in Dubai sometimes. Several elevators so you are not standing around waiting which can happen in busier parts of the city. The building has two gyms with actual light coming in not just dull basement rooms and four pools spread around the garden areas. The pools all have a different feel sometimes you hear kids laughing in one while another might just have a couple people doing morning laps. Downstairs the gardens are landscaped but always fairly green so if you need to get outside after a long day or week you will be glad for the space. I once watched a pick up basketball game down there as the sun set and it really felt like a tight knit community.
Bluewaters is just good for families or anyone looking to be close to Dubai Marina and Jumeirah Beach but without the ongoing crowds. The coffee shop is never far from your lobby and by lunchtime you see people wandering out for a bite or just to grab fresh juice. You might spot couples taking a walk or kids biking especially when the heat drops and the air finally cools in the evening. It is got that island living vibe but you never really miss a city convenience.
